Isotopes Top OKC in Game Two

Albuquerque (30-27) took game two of the series from Oklahoma City (31-24) 4-2 behind a stellar performance by Matt Palmer and a go-ahead two run homer in the sixth by right fielder Jeremy Moore. Moore went 2-for-3 with two RBI and a run.

Palmer (2-3, 4.73) was touched up for two first-inning runs on a Brandon Laird home run, but settled in to hold the RedHawks scoreless over the next six frames in his best outing of the season. The righty fired seven innings, striking out a season-high eight batters earning the win. He allowed five hits, a homer and a walk.

Righty Javy Guerra pitched two scoreless innings in his first game back with the Isotopes after being optioned by the Los Angeles Dodgers on May 31. He earned his first save of the season, allowing two hits while striking out a batter.

The Isotopes responded to Laird's first inning home run in the bottom half of the frame on centerfielder Chili Buss' (1-for-2, 2RBI, 2B, BB) eighth double of the season. Elian Herrera, who singled, scored on the play.

Buss drove in his second run of the game on a sacrifice fly to score shortstop Dee Gordon (1-for-2, R, 2B, 2 BB) in the second inning, tying the game at two. Gordon doubled in the inning for the 10th time this year, tying the 2013 team lead.

Left fielder Matt Angle tied Buss for the club lead in triples with his fourth three bagger of the season in the fourth. After two scoreless innings by both sides, Moore blasted a two-run shot for his first home run as an Isotope. His long ball gave Albuquerque their first lead of the game and turned out to be the deciding runs.

Ross Seaton (5-3, 7.60) suffered the loss for Oklahoma City. The righty allowed four runs on seven hits.

Albuquerque continues their series tomorrow against the Oklahoma City RedHawks for the third game of their four game set. Two righties will take the mound with Angel Castro (4-2, 3.20) going for the Isotopes and Jarred Cosart (5-2, 2.66) slated for the RedHawks.
